The Woody Show host Jeff ‘Woody’ Fife will be the recipient of the annual “Kidd Kraddick Award” at Talentmasters’ 38th Annual MSBC this August.
Based at iHeartMedia’s “Alt 98.7” KYSR Los Angeles since 2014 and syndicated by Premiere Networks, Woody has also hosted mornings at stations including KPNT St. Louis and KITS San Francisco. The award is named in honor of the late Kidd Kraddick recognizing those of unparalleled success, inimitable style, authenticity, exemplary service to their community, and a consistent ability to inspire other shows and personalities.
The award nominee is selected by the previous year’s recipients, “The Johnjay & Rich Show” hosts Johnjay Van Es and Rich Berra. Past honorees include Bert Weiss of the syndicated “The Bert Show,” YEA Media Group’s “The Kidd Kraddick Show,” KRBE-FM Houston’s “The Roula & Ryan Show with Eric,” Charlotte’s “The Ace & TJ Show,” 97X Quad Cities’ “Dwyer & Michaels Show,” Big 105.9 Miami’s Paul Castronovo, Seattle’s BJ Shea, Rochester’s “Brother Wease,” Mojo of Channel 955 Detroit’s “Mojo in the Morning” and KDWB-FM Minneapolis’ Dave Ryan.
